José María Córdova International Airport is the most important airport in the department of Antioquia and western Colombia. It opened in 1985

International traffic departs from JMC towards destinations in the United States, Panama, Costa Rica, Venezuela, Ecuador, Peru, Curaçao and Spain. The busiest international cities served are Panama City, Panama, along with Miami and Fort Lauderdale, Florida (USA). The airport also serves domestic flights to most major Colombian cities.

The airport is named honoring Jose Maria Cordova, a native of Antioquia and the city where the airport was built, who held senior positions in the administration, and played important roles in the history of the nation.
